Bob "Woody" Popik, the man who played the hits at Baltimore Ravens and Orioles home games for more than a decade, has died after weeks-long battle with pancreatic cancer. He was 59. News of Popik’s death was shared on his Facebook account, where dozens of friends and family members paid tribute to the longtime stadium DJ.
Since the 1970 AFL-NFL merger, there have been just four teams to start the season 1-5 and make the postseason. The Ravens want to become the fifth — joining the 1970 Bengals, 2015 Chiefs, 2018 Colts, and Washington in 2020. The odds, clearly, are not great.
